Key Features and Applications of Borosilicate Glass Balls



Borosilicate glass balls are spherical objects made from borosilicate glass, a type of glass known for its high thermal resistance, durability, and chemical inertness? Borosilicate glass contains boron trioxide, which gives it unique properties compared to other types of glass.

Here are some key features and applications of borosilicate glass balls:

Thermal Resistance: Borosilicate glass has excellent thermal shock resistance, meaning it can withstand rapid temperature changes without cracking or breaking. This property makes borosilicate glass balls suitable for use in high-temperature environments, such as in industrial processes or laboratory equipment.

Durability: Borosilicate glass is highly durable and resistant to chemical corrosion. Borosilicate Glass Balls Supplier can withstand exposure to harsh chemicals and acids, making them suitable for use in corrosive environments.

Precision Applications: Due to their uniform size and smooth surface, borosilicate glass balls are used in precision applications, such as ball bearings, flow meters, check valves, and calibration standards. Their consistent size and shape ensure reliable performance in these applications.

Optical Properties: Borosilicate glass has excellent optical clarity and transparency, making it suitable for use in optical instruments and devices. Borosilicate glass balls may be used as lenses, prisms, or optical filters in various optical systems.

Laboratory and Scientific Use: Borosilicate glass balls are commonly used in laboratory equipment and scientific instruments. They may be used as mixing beads in laboratory vials, as reaction vessels in chemical synthesis, or as components in precision measurement devices.

Decorative and Artistic Applications: Borosilicate glass balls are also used in decorative and artistic projects due to their clarity and durability. Artists and craftsmen use borosilicate glass balls for glassblowing, lampworking, and other glass art techniques to create sculptures, ornaments, and jewelry.

Overall, borosilicate glass balls are versatile materials with a wide range of applications across industries, including industrial, scientific, optical, and artistic fields. Their unique combination of thermal resistance, durability, and optical properties makes them valuable components in various applications.
